3:Customer registration form Operating voltage The SDA 2175 is available in a version for 115V mains voltage and in a version for 230V mains voltage. Check the label on the SDA 2175 rear panel and verify that you have the version with the proper voltage for your area.

A massive power supply with a 650VA toroidal transformer and more than 40000 microF capacitors ensures that the SDA 2175 can deliver the current to drive even the most demanding loudspeakers.
Fig 2: SDA 2175 rear panel. Mains Connector Mains voltage to the SDA 2175 is applied via an IEC320 type connector. The supplied cable with safety ground should be used to connect the SDA 2175 to a mains outlet. WARNING: Connect the power input only to the AC source printed on the label.
The SDA 2175 has input sockets for both balanced and unbalanced signals, but only one may be used at a time. The XLR and phono sockets are internally connected in parallel, so only one set of the connectors should be connected externally. ALWAYS use EITHER the XLR inputs OR the phono inputs.
If there is a plug in the TRIGGER IN socket, the SDA 2175 standby mode is controlled by the voltage on the plug. With no voltage applied, the SDA 2175 will go into standby mode. If a DC voltage of 5-24V or a 50Hz AC voltage of 4-17Vrms is applied, the SDA 2175 will go into OPERATE mode.
